Sexual Function: Use It or Lose It
According to recent studies, the old “use it or lose it” wives tale may be true. Finnish researchers have released statements upon new studies, showing that men who have sex at least once a week, in comparison to men who have sex less than once a week, are at a lower risk of developing erectile dysfunction. This new study was conducted on a group of over nine hundred men, all ranging from 55 to 75 years old. High cholesterol problems hinder the body’s mechanism to work well. In the first place, why do we have cholesterol in our bodies? Cholesterol has manifold functions, and it naturally exists in the outer layers of the human cell. Cholesterol is important for hormone production, cell membrane formation and other vital body functions. However, high cholesterol can lead to coronary heart disease (CAD) and is the leading cause of cardiac arrest.
